High expression of lncRNA-SNHG7 is associated with poor prognosis in hepatocellular carcinoma

Abstract: Expression of long non-coding RNA SNHG7 (lncRNA-SNHG7) and its clinical significance in hepatocellular carcinoma (HCC) were explored. Quantitative real-time polymerase chain reaction (qRT-PCR) was used to detect the expression level of lncRNA-SNHG7 in cancer tissues. Kaplan-Meier curves and multivariate Cox proportional models were used to study the impact on clinical outcome. “…Interestingly, Cox regression analyses confirm the predictive value of SNHG7 as an independent prognostic factor among cancerous patients. This is particularly reported in several district experiments on human malignancies such as gastric cancer, cervical cancer, HCC, and liver metastasis following hepatectomy in CRC patients ( Table 2 ) ( Zeng et al, 2019 ; Zhang et al, 2020a ; Zhang et al, 2020c ; Shen et al, 2020 ). As for diagnostic values, an area under curve (AUC) of 0.84 in the receiver operating characteristic (ROC) curve is reported for SNHG7 in CRC patients ( Hu et al, 2019 ).…”
